Our office receptionist gets the normal breaks. Other people in the office cover the front desk while she’s at lunch or needs a quick 5 minute break. We rotate weekly who has to cover the front desk during the receptionist’s breaks. Even our big boss (the dept head) takes his turn.
It is a unique position because there’s has to be someone at the front desk at all times. Even a pee break is too long to leave the reception area unattended.
Our receptionist unlocks the front doors in the morning, turns on the lights etc. Basically throws out the welcome mat for the days work.
